Tottori Sand Dunes 鳥取砂丘
This is one of my favourite photographs that I have taken in Japan. Tottori’s Sand Dunes, called Tottori Sakyu 鳥取砂丘, are famous throughout Japan, and receive many visitors. The movie Woman of the Dunes 砂の女 was filmed here.
